WebPartManager.OnWebPartClosed(WebPartEventArgs)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Löst das WebPartClosed Ereignis aus, um zu signalisieren, dass ein Steuerelement von einer Seite entfernt wurde.
protected:
virtual void OnWebPartClosed(System::Web::UI::WebControls::WebParts::WebPartEventArgs ^ e);
protected virtual void OnWebPartClosed(System.Web.UI.WebControls.WebParts.WebPartEventArgs e);
abstract member OnWebPartClosed : System.Web.UI.WebControls.WebParts.WebPartEventArgs -> unit
override this.OnWebPartClosed : System.Web.UI.WebControls.WebParts.WebPartEventArgs -> unit
Protected Overridable Sub OnWebPartClosed (e As WebPartEventArgs)
Parameter
Ein WebPartEventArgs Objekt, das die Ereignisdaten enthält.
Hinweise
Die OnWebPartClosed Methode löst das WebPartClosed Ereignis aus, um anzugeben, dass ein Steuerelement (oder ein WebPart anderes Server- oder Benutzersteuerelement) auf einer Seite erfolgreich geschlossen wurde.
Um ein WebPart Steuerelement zu schließen, bedeutet es, es von einer Seite zu entfernen, damit es nicht gerendert wird, und es auch in einem speziellen Halteobjekt, das als Seitenkatalog bezeichnet wird, platzieren. Ein Seitenkatalog, der dem PageCatalogPart Steuerelement entspricht, verwaltet Verweise auf geschlossene WebPart Steuerelemente für jede Seite. Wenn ein PageCatalogPart Steuerelement auf einer Seite innerhalb einer CatalogZone Zone deklariert wird, können Benutzer die Seite in den Kataloganzeigemodus wechseln und der Seite alle Steuerelemente hinzufügen, die zuvor geschlossen wurden.
Die OnWebPartClosed Methode bietet Entwicklern die Möglichkeit, einen benutzerdefinierten Handler für das WebPartClosed Ereignis zu erstellen. Seitenentwickler können einen benutzerdefinierten Handler für das Ereignis hinzufügen, indem sie dem OnWebPartClosed Element auf einer Seite ein <asp:webpartmanager> Attribut hinzufügen und dann dem Attribut einen benutzerdefinierten Methodennamen zuweisen. Eine nützliche Aufgabe, die ein Entwickler möglicherweise in dieser Methode ausführen kann, besteht darin, einen Platzhalter anstelle des geschlossenen Steuerelements anzuzeigen, vollständig mit einer QuickInfo, die Benutzer darüber informiert, wie das Steuerelement wieder zur Seite hinzugefügt wird.